Choose a Daily Schedule Format WebA system administrator can use automated tasks to perform periodic backups, monitor the system, run custom scripts, and so on. Fedora comes with the following automated task utilities: cron, anacron, at, and batch. Every utility is intended for scheduling a different job type: while Cron and Anacron schedule recurring jobs, At and Batch ...
